How they compare
Russian Federation currently reports 58.6% against 56.1% in Belarus, a difference of 2.5%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 11 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Belarus ahead.
Belarus ranks 36th and Russian Federation ranks 34th of 71 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Belarus averaged higher in 1 and Russian Federation in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Belarus | Russian Federation |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 21.4% | 20.1% | 1.3% | Belarus |
| 2020s | 49.0% | 54.0% | 5.0% | Russian Federation |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
